Dig Deep Conference Report Posted on 20 Mar 2017  |  Mission, Education & Discipleship

In the very hospitable surroundings of South Wishaw parish church, a group of around sixty people from congregations across Hamilton Presbytery and beyond gathered on 28th January 2017 to hear a range of speakers tell their stories and recount their experiences of working in situation where there were few or no children. ST ANDREW’S HOSPICE Posted on 09 Mar 2017

At the March meeting of Hamilton Presbytery, the Moderator welcomed Ms Louise Arthur, a member of the fund-raising team for St. Andrew’s Hospice, Airdrie to Presbytery, and invited her to address the members. She spoke on the history, services, and values of the Hospice, together with the challenges being faced to ensure compliance with the environmental requirements of Health Inspection Scotland, especially in relation to modern room standards. She advised the Presbytery that the hospice was at an important stage in its re-development programme with an urgent need of support for the Capital Fund which remained significantly short of their target, being just over the half-way mark. She appealed to congregations to continue to support the work of the hospice, and do what they could to assist with the Capital Appeal. Her address was warmly received.
